欢迎来到论文网! 识人者智,自知者明,通过生日认识自己! 生日公历:
网站地图 | Tags标签 | RSS
论文网 论文网8200余万篇毕业论文、各种论文格式和论文范文以及9千多种期刊杂志的论文征稿及论文投稿信息,是论文写作、论文投稿和论文发表的论文参考网站,也是科研人员论文检测和发表论文的理想平台。lunwenf@yeah.net。
您当前的位置:首页 > 毕业论文 > 计算机毕业论文

高校研究生院学籍管理系统的设计与开发_信息系统-论文网

时间:2014-05-07  作者:郝梦
在开发工具选择方面,本系统将选择Delphi7企业版+ODAC组件作为C/S交互部分的开发工具。这是一款面向对象的强大的快速开发工具,集中了PB和VB开发工具的优点,功能强大,易学易用,且具有较好的兼容性。同时,本系统将选择MyEclipse作为B/S交互部分的开发工具,结合目前较为流行的SSH架构,采用Tomcat5作为WEB服务器来完成学籍管理系统web服务部分的开发。

4.2.4系统安全设计

信息安全是信息系统建设的首要问题,信息的失窃或篡改常常给系统带来毁灭性的打击。学籍管理系统中的一些关键信息(如学籍基本信息、学籍变动信息等)的安全是至关重要的,必须在信息系统建设的设计阶段,制定可靠的安全策略。

系统良好的安全性设计,可以有效地保护数据库,防止不合法的访问和破坏。系统的安全设计主要包括网络安全设计、操作系统安全设计、数据库安全设计和应用程序安全(ID)设计四个方面。

在网络安全设计方面,本系统将采用虚拟局域网(VLAN)服务和防火墙技术。将系统的所有服务器都建立在虚拟子网内,用防火墙与校园网隔离,只允许安全的网络协议通过,如HTTP协议等,其他如FTP、TELNET协议限制执行。

在操作系统安全设计方面,利用操作系统安全功能,对操作系统的用户、用户组及其访问权限作严格的规定,关掉可能导致安全漏洞的服务,如Telnet、Ftp、SendMail等,同时安装系统防火墙、杀毒软件等来避免病毒攻击。

在数据库安全设计方面,本系统将充分利用Oracle9i数据库管理系统强大的安全功能,如利用数据库账号、数据库视图、账号操作权限等对访问进行控制。关键数据采用数据维护触发器记录操作信息、操作时间等进行跟踪,提供数据修改踪迹查询等。数据库安全管理是一个多层次的访问管理。将用户登录账号增加到数据库服务器,用户才可访问数据库。将数据库中的一些对象,如表、视图、列、存储过程等的访问权限授予某用户,该用户才可以在此权限范围内访问数据库对象。只授予用户对某视图的使用权限,可使用户不直接对基表操作,而是通过视图间接地对基表中可见的部分操作,提高了数据库的安全性。

在应用程序安全设计方面,本系统将对应用程序加密并验证用户的ID号。系统会根据用户角色的不同分配不同级别的操作权限,从而有效地限制了使用系统应用程序的用户。

5学籍管理系统实施

通过上文学籍管理系统的分析和设计,本文认为系统实施主要包括二个部分,分别是C/S交互平台的建立和实施,B/S交互平台的建立和实施。下面,将主要通过对系统界面的一些截图,来进行系统实施各部分的介绍。

5.1C/S交互平台的建立和实施

本系统采用Delphi7企业版+ODAC作为C/S交互平台的开发工具,首先需要在Delphi企业版中安装ODAC组件。

5.3B/S交互平台的建立和实施

本系统B/S交互平台主要采用MyEclipse+SSH架构+Tomcat进行开发。启动MyEclipse开发环境,配置好Tomcat服务器后,就需要完成SSH架构的搭建。首先要导入系统开发所需要的Struts包、Spring包和Hibernate包,并完成相应配置文件的修改和配置。

用合法的用户登录进入后,学生就可以点击左侧的学籍管理选项,进行学籍信息的查看和部分资料的在线下载了。

6学籍管理系统效果评价

6.1学籍管理系统待改进的问题

1)后期应努力实现将C/S+B/S结合的混合开发模式向纯B/S模式进行转化,以最大限度的方便各类用户群体的使用,当然,前提是保证数据信息的安全。

随着网络技术的更快更高发展,未来的管理信息系统必将向Browser/Server的结构模式转变。因为现有的多层Client/Server结构在客户端虽然是“瘦客户”,但毕竟不是“零客户”,客户端软件的故障和升级维护不是很方便。而且这种结构也不利于整体结构的升级改造。所以本文认为在未来,是可以考虑完全采用Browser/Server结构模式进行系统开发的。

尽管利用现有的技术水平,可以很好的开发出适合高校研究生院使用的综合教务系统,但是还有很多不完善的地方需要改进,以适合未来的需求。

2)加强学籍管理系统的体系结构和接口的设计。目前设计的学籍管理系统作为高校研究生院综合教务系统的一个基础子系统,还未能完全整合与研究生院有关的各个系统,比如财务系统、一卡通系统等。这样就存在很多数据不统一问题。

参考文献
1 钟庚生,江泽涛.基于角色管理的研究生信息管理系统分析与建设[J].计算机与现代化,2009(1):P4-P6.
3 张蕾.论研究生学籍管理系统的科学化[J].中国科教创新导刊,2008(20):P205.
4 赵力,王涛,金代志.高等院校学籍管理系统功能设计[J].商业经济,2009(15):P207-P208.
5 刘琪.浅析学籍管理信息系统的构建[J].科技资讯,2007(9):P87.
6 曾蒸,黄玲.学籍管理系统的功能设计与实现[J].大众科技,2009(1):P26-P27.
7 吴天准.Delphi 7程序设计技巧与实例[M].北京:中国铁道出版社,2003.
8 James Perry,Gerald Post著,钟鸣,郝玉洁,杨桦等译.Oracle基础教程[M].北京:人民邮电出版社,2008.
9 飞思科技产品研发中心.Delphi 7数据库应用开发[M].北京电子工业出版社,2003.
10 陈景艳.管理信息系统[M].北京:中国铁道出版社,2001.
11 陈维斌,喻小光.基于Intranet的分布式学籍管理系统的设计与实现[J].计算机应用,2002,22(9): P62-P64.
12 丁春晖,闫静.一个学籍管理系统的建设与实现[J].科技信息,2009(21):P57,P77.
13 张爱娣.学生学籍管理系统的设计初探[J].科学导刊,2009(4):P115,P134.

查看相关论文专题
加入收藏  打印本文
上一篇论文:项目教学法在VFP实验教学模式中的应用研究_学习兴趣-论文网
下一篇论文:高校计算机基础教育改革探讨_考核方法-论文网
毕业论文分类
行政管理毕业论文 工商管理毕业论文
护理毕业论文 会计毕业论文
会计专业毕业论文 英语专业毕业论文
大学毕业论文 硕士毕业论文
计算机毕业论文 市场营销毕业论文
物流管理毕业论文 法学毕业论文
相关计算机毕业论文
最新计算机毕业论文
读者推荐的计算机毕业论文